Transaction d81ba557902eeaa4b288d5b37f36cdc4db0d32b59cfbccc976ad58f36a5eb91c

block
f05292100b61fc30bb99a9901850966ae884c1804d981523f3e8497d1ed13783

10 Inputs

56 Outputs